创建高效网站需经历需求分析、设计规划、前端开发、后端开发、测试优化及上线维护等环节。
随着互联网的飞速发展,网站作为企业或个人展示自我、推广产品和服务的重要平台,其重要性愈发凸显,一个设计美观、功能实用且易于访问的网站,能够为用户提供良好的体验,并帮助企业吸引潜在客户,提升品牌知名度,本篇文章将详细介绍一个从零开始建设高效网站的完整流程,包括规划、设计、开发、测试及发布等环节。
一、需求分析与规划
在开始建设网站之前,首先需要明确网站的目标用户群和具体功能需求,这一步骤通常由项目团队中的项目经理或产品经理负责,了解目标市场的需求和竞争情况是关键,还需要考虑网站的技术架构、性能优化以及未来扩展的可能性,还应制定一份详尽的预算计划,并确定项目的整体时间表。
二、设计阶段
设计阶段是将网站视觉风格、布局和用户体验细节具体化的过程,这一阶段通常分为两个部分:前端设计和后端开发,前端设计涉及到网站的页面布局、颜色方案、字体选择以及图标等元素的选择与排版,而后端开发则专注于网站的功能实现和数据库结构设计。
三、前端开发与技术实现
在完成设计图稿之后,接下来就是前端开发阶段了,这一步骤包括编写HTML、CSS以及JavaScript代码来实现页面的基本布局和交互效果,同时也要确保网站能够在不同浏览器和设备上保持良好的兼容性,对于复杂的业务逻辑和数据处理,则需要进行后端开发工作,如使用Python、Java等编程语言搭建服务器端框架,并与前端进行数据交换。
四、后端开发与数据库管理
后端开发的主要任务包括构建服务器端逻辑、API接口以及数据库模型设计,根据网站的具体需求,可以采用MySQL、MongoDB等不同的数据库管理系统来存储数据,还需考虑安全性问题,比如对敏感信息进行加密处理,防止SQL注入等攻击手段。
五、测试与调试
测试阶段旨在发现并修复网站存在的所有问题,包括但不限于功能错误、兼容性问题、性能瓶颈以及用户体验缺陷等,为了确保网站能够稳定运行,通常会进行多种类型的测试,如单元测试、集成测试、系统测试以及压力测试等。
六、部署上线
经过充分的测试后,就可以将网站正式上线了,这一过程中,除了上传网站文件到服务器外,还需要配置域名解析、安装必要的软件包(如PHP、Node.js)以及设置SSL证书等安全措施,同时也要做好备份策略,以防意外情况发生。
七、维护与更新
网站上线后并不代表工作的结束,为了保证网站持续提供高质量的服务,还需要定期进行维护和更新,这包括监控网站运行状态、修复已知故障、优化用户体验、添加新功能以及响应用户反馈等,通过这种方式不断迭代改进,才能使网站始终保持活力与竞争力。
建设一个成功的网站是一个复杂而精细的过程,需要从多方面综合考量,通过遵循上述步骤,不仅能够有效提升网站的质量,还能更好地满足用户需求。